Abstract:Nanoporous electrodes with extremely small pores have been developed for improved supercapacitors and electroanalysis. Ion transport into nanoconfined spaces has been studied using nanoporous carbon. Herein, we explore the size effect and hydrophobicity of ions on the charging dynamics using microporous Pt by cyclic voltammetry and electrochemical impedance spectroscopy.
